#e7de14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e7de14 is composed of 90.6% red, 87.1%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.9%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 57.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#e7de14 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#cfbd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#e7de14 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e7de14 has RGB values of R:231, G:222,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.91,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15195668.

Hex triplet e7de14 #e7de14
RGB Decimal 231, 222, 20 rgb(231,222,20)
RGB Percent 90.6, 87.1, 7.8 rgb(90.6%,87.1%,7.8%)
CMYK 0, 4, 91, 9
HSL 57.4°, 84.1, 49.2 hsl(57.4,84.1%,49.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 57.4°, 91.3, 90.6
Web Safe ffcc00 #ffcc00
CIE-LAB 86.644, -15.422, 84.061
XYZ 59.203, 69.283, 10.916
xyY 0.425, 0.497, 69.283
CIE-LCH 86.644, 85.464, 100.396
CIE-LUV 86.644, 12.959, 93.367
Hunter-Lab 83.237, -18.704, 50.49
Binary 11100111, 11011110, 00010100

Shades and Tints of #e7de14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0e01 is the darkest color, while #fffff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7de14

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868675 is the less saturated color, while #faf001 is the most saturated one.
